php开发工程师怎么学
时间 : 2023-04-03 11:09:01声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
PHP是一种广泛使用的服务器端脚本语言,主要用于Web开发。作为一名PHP开发工程师,你需要掌握以下几点。
一、基础语法和数据类型
掌握PHP的基础语法和数据类型是非常重要的。以变量作为例子,你需要了解如何定义和使用变量,以及PHP支持的不同数据类型,例如字符串、数字、布尔型等等。同时,熟练掌握运算符(算术、逻辑、比较等)和流程控制结构(if/else、for、while等)也是必要的基础知识。
二、面向对象编程
面向对象编程(OOP)是PHP开发的核心概念。你需要掌握类、对象、属性、方法、继承等概念,以及如何编写和管理类库。通过使用面向对象编程,你能够更加模块化、可维护和可扩展的开发应用程序。
三、网页开发
PHP最重要的应用是用于网页开发。你需要了解如何使用HTML和CSS来创建和布局网页,以及如何结合PHP来实现动态功能,例如表单处理、用户验证、数据库操作等等。
四、数据库操作
PHP通常与数据库结合使用,例如MySQL、Oracle等等。你需要掌握如何使用PHP连接数据库,以及如何执行SQL查询、更新和删除等等操作。同时,你还需要了解PHP中的数据安全问题,例如SQL注入、跨站点脚本攻击等等。
五、框架和工具
为了提高开发效率和代码质量,PHP开发工程师通常使用开发框架和工具。例如Laravel、Symfony、CodeIgniter等等框架,以及Composer、PHPUnit等工具。你需要了解框架和工具的基本原理和使用方法,以便更好地应用于实际开发中。
在学习PHP开发的过程中,你需要不断地学习和实践。阅读PHP技术文章、参加PHP相关的技术交流和活动、贡献开源项目等等方式,能够帮助你了解最新的PHP技术发展,提高自己的编程技能。
如果你想成为一名PHP开发工程师,以下是一些步骤和技巧,可以帮助您学习和掌握PHP开发技能。
1. 基本的编程理论知识
要成为一名PHP开发工程师,你需要掌握针对程序设计的某些基础知识,如命令行知识,ASCII 码、Unicode,变量、数据类型、控制流等等。建议如果您没有关于计算机科学或程序设计方面的基础知识,您可以学习一些有关这方面的专业课程或自学相关书籍。
2. 熟悉PHP语言的基础
要成为一名PHP开发者,很关键的是学会PHP编程语言的基础知识。通过学习PHP函数、变量、数组等基础知识,您可以很快地了解PHP的基础知识。如需了解更多关于PHP语言的消息,请查看 PHP 基础知识或 PHP 编程语言说明。
3. 练习写代码
当您学习了基本的PHP语言,下一步需要做的是刻意练习写代码。通过练习写一些简单的代码程序,您可以逐渐掌握PHP编程语言的规范和惯例,并准确地遵循PHP社区的标准和约定。可以通过编写一些简单的HTML网页或后台应用程序,以及使用PHP编写的脚本来开始练习。
4. 注册社区网站
PHP社区是一个查找有关PHP语言问题的宝典。在许多PHP语言的站点中,你可以向其他PHP程序员寻求帮助或知识。例如 Stack Overflow或 Github等欢迎PHP开发人员的网站。
5. 使用开源工具和框架
从经验丰富的PHP开发人员身上学习并使用他们的经验是一种很好的方法。使用开源工具和框架,如Laravel、CodeIgniter或CakePHP等,可以帮助您快速找到最佳实践和解决方案,并且改进自己的编程技能。通过使用开源工具和框架来编写程序,您可以了解代码的组织和模块化原则。
总之,成为一名PHP开发工程师需要坚持并不懈努力学习新技能和知识。与其他开发者的交流、阅读教程以及编写代码并积极参与开源社区是一个很快的方法。此外,要成为一个高水平的PHP开发人员,您需要为自己明示的目标持续更新自己的知识体系。
上一篇
php怎么连接两个表格
下一篇
php怎么留后门修改数据
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章